Monterey, MA, nestled in the southern Berkshires, is a mountain town known for its natural beauty and strong community ties. The area boasts numerous hiking trails and fishing lakes, including the popular Lake Garfield, which offers year-round activities such as swimming, kayaking, fishing, and ice skating. Beartown State Forest provides 12,000 acres for hiking, camping, mountain biking, and winter sports. Monterey's housing market features early 20th-century cottages and lakefront properties, with many being converted into larger year-round homes. The Southern Berkshire Regional School District, which includes Mount Everett Regional School, is noted for its smaller class sizes and individual attention. Residents often travel to nearby towns like Lee and Great Barrington for shopping and dining, with Great Barrington offering a variety of bakeries, cheese shops, and international cuisine. Cultural attractions are abundant, with the Boston Symphony Orchestra's summer home at Tanglewood in Lenox, just 15 miles north, and local art exhibitions at the Monterey Library. Despite its rural charm, Monterey is car-dependent, with main roads like Route 23 and Route 57 connecting to larger highways. The town is about 50 miles west of Springfield and 20 miles south of Pittsfield.
On average, homes in Monterey, MA sell after 78 days on the market compared to the national average of 55 days. The median sale price for homes in Monterey, MA over the last 12 months is $743,750, down 17% from the median home sale price over the previous 12 months.
